KIN 481
Med Aspects of Sports Medicine
Credit: 3 or 4 hours.
Focuses on the identification and management of common medical conditions and illnesses associated with the physically active population. Content will address common assessment and evaluation procedures and the development of an appropriate management plan for the return to activity and/or continuation of current physical activity status. Emphasis will be given to the role of the Athletic Trainer. 3 undergraduate hours. 4 graduate hours. Prerequisite: KIN 325 or consent of instructor.
